How much do golf instructor j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 8, 2026, the average hourly pay for golf instructor in Chicago, IL is $26.99,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$20.58 and $31.73 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a golf instructor?

To thrive as a Golf Instructor, you need a solid understanding of golf techniques, swing analysis, and instructional methods, often supported by certifications from organizations such as the PGA or LPGA. Familiarity with video swing analysis tools, launch monitors, and lesson scheduling software is often required. Outstanding communication, patience, and motivational skills help instructors effectively teach diverse learners and tailor their coaching strategies. These capabilities ensure that students of all ages and skill levels receive clear, constructive feedback and enjoy a positive, productive learning environment.

What does a golf instructor do?

A typical day for a Golf Instructor involves giving private or group lessons, assessing students' swings and game strategies, and providing tailored feedback for improvement. Instructors may also spend time planning lesson content, communicating with clients to schedule sessions, and using technology such as video swing analysis to enhance instruction. Collaboration with golf course staff and coordinating junior or adult clinics can also be part of the role. The schedule can vary based on client demand and may include evenings or weekends, making flexibility important. This variety keeps the role dynamic and offers regular opportunities to build relationships with both new and returning students.

Do golf instructors make good money?

Golf instructors' earnings vary based on experience, location, and the number of students they teach. They typically earn hourly wages or lesson fees, with some also earning commissions or tips, and income can range from modest to high depending on their reputation and client base.

What is a golf instructor?

A Golf Instructor is a professional who teaches individuals or groups how to play golf or improve their existing skills. They provide instruction on techniques such as grip, stance, swing, and putting, while also offering guidance on course strategy and etiquette. Golf Instructors may work at golf courses, driving ranges, or privately, tailoring lessons to suit players of all skill levels. Many instructors are certified by organizations like the PGA or USGTF, ensuring they meet industry standards.

How do you become a golf instructor?

To become a golf instructor, you typically need to obtain a golf teaching certification from a recognized organization such as the PGA or LPGA, which involves completing training programs and passing exams. Gaining experience through playing and coaching, developing strong communication skills, and understanding golf swing mechanics are also important steps in the process.

AHPD OVERVIEW

The Arlington Heights Park District (AHPD) is a public park and recreation agency located in Arlington Heights, Illinois-one of the largest communities in Chicago's prestigious northwest suburban corridor. Our mission is to enrich the community by providing fun, accessible and impactful recreation and facilities for every age and season. However, you choose to recreate, we have something for you. We aim to serve everyone equally and fairly across our 29 facilities-including five community centers with outdoor pools, Arlington Ridge Center, two tennis clubs, two public golf clubs, Lake Arlington, Arlington Heights Historical Museum, and Senior Center-and 58 parks across 716 acres of land. In our 100-year history, we have earned multiple distinctions recognizing our high-quality standards of excellence, including three National Gold Medal Awards, maintaining a Moody's AAA bond rating for nine years, and receiving multiple awards for fiscal responsibility.
